I will start by saying that I have never named a car in my nearly 30 years of owning them. On the Cadillac app you can name the car, so I decided to do something that wasn't generic. If you did something similar, share your car's name and why you chose it.

Name: Adamas
Adamas is from ancient Greece and is the root word for "diamond".

Directly translated, it means "unconquerable".

My car is Black Diamond tricoat, and I like to pretend it can't be beat 😎

I've always named my vehicles as I believe every car has its own idiosyncrasies & therefore, a "soul" of sorts. The ones currently in the stable:
  • 2022 Genesis GV80 - "Genny" (for obvious reasons)
  • 2023 Chevy Stingray Vette - "Rapide" (she's pretty quick!)
  • 2016 Subbie Forester - "Gump" (movie reference)
  • 2016 Ford F-150 - "Blackie" (exterior color)
  • 2023 5BW - "Pegasus"
    • as in the winged horse of Greek mythology that came from the blood of Medusa when she was killed
    • carried Zeus' thunderbolts & the 5BW's exhaust note is a good substitute
    • the symbol of divine flight & therefore fitting for the ludicrous speeds this car is capable of
    • My 5BW is Rift Metallic so, essentially, white -- the color of Pegasus
